100,000 civil servants set to strike over pay, pensions and job cuts
General secretary for the Public and Commercial Services union Mark Serwotka has called for ‘substantial proposals’ to avoid walk-outs (Picture: Getty Images)
More than 100,000 civil servants, including Border Force staff and driving test examiners, are set to go on strike in a row over pay, pensions and job cuts.
